Before you rent out your apartment in Spain, here are some things to think about.

There are a few crucial things to think about before you put your home up for rent. First, make sure that your unit fulfills all of the local rental laws, such as having the right licenses and following safety rules. You should also determine whether you want to rent out your flat for a short or lengthy time. Short-term rentals, particularly in locations with a lot of tourists, may make more money, but they need to be managed more often. Long-term rentals, on the other hand, may provide a more consistent source of income, but they may not be as flexible.
